PLC (Programmable Logic Controller) – наиболее распространенное устройство для автоматизации промышленного производства. Оно представляет собой электронный контроллер, способный управлять различными процессами на основе заранее запрограммированной логики. PLC используется в различных отраслях, включая промышленность, авиацию, энергетику и даже домашние приложения.
Принцип работы PLC основан на выполнении последовательности программных инструкций, которые определяют состояние и поведение управляемого процесса. Контроллер считывает входные сигналы от датчиков и, на основе программы, принимает решения о выдаче соответствующих команд на управляемые устройства. Это позволяет автоматизировать процессы и обеспечить высокую точность и надежность в работе системы.
Преимущества использования PLC включают высокую гибкость и перенастраиваемость системы, возможность удаленного мониторинга и управления, а также простоту программирования и настройки устройства. Благодаря этим преимуществам, PLC стал неотъемлемой частью современного промышленного производства, позволяя значительно повысить его эффективность и производительность.
Основные принципы работы PLC
В основе работы PLC лежит периодическое сканирование, или циклическое выполнение программы. Цикл сканирования начинается с чтения входных сигналов от датчиков и других устройств, подключенных к PLC. Затем PLC обрабатывает эти данные, выполняя логические операции, математические вычисления и другие операции в соответствии с заданной программой.
Управление выходными устройствами, такими как моторы, клапаны, световые индикаторы и т. д., осуществляется путем отправки выходных сигналов из PLC. Эти сигналы могут быть также модулированы для управления аналоговыми устройствами.
Сама программа в PLC может быть создана с помощью специальных программных средств, которые предоставляются производителями PLC. Они обеспечивают возможность создания логических схем, задания условий и логических операций, подключения входных и выходных устройств.
Основным преимуществом PLC является его гибкость и возможность быстрой перепрограммирования. Это позволяет применять PLC в различных областях промышленности, таких как производство, энергетика, автомобильная промышленность и другие, где требуется точное и надежное управление процессами.
Благодаря своей надежности, PLC широко используется для автоматизации систем в промышленности, где требуется высокая степень контроля и управления.
Архитектура PLC
1. Процессор: процессор является основным элементом PLC и отвечает за выполнение программ и управление процессами. Он выполняет логические операции, обрабатывает данные и управляет другими компонентами PLC.
Компоненты процессора: | Назначение: |
---|---|
Центральный процессор (CPU) | |
Часы реального времени | Обеспечивают отслеживание времени и временных интервалов в системе PLC. |
Программная память | Хранит программы управления и данные. |
2. Память: память PLC используется для хранения программ управления, данных и параметров. Различные типы памяти включают оперативную память (RAM) для временного хранения данных, постоянную память (EEPROM или флеш-память) для долгосрочного хранения данных и энергонезависимую память (EEPROM) для сохранения данных при отключении питания.
Архитектура PLC позволяет реализовывать различные задачи автоматизации, обеспечивая надежность, гибкость и эффективность в процессе управления системами и производственными процессами.
Программирование PLC
Программирование PLC осуществляется с использованием специализированных языков и программного обеспечения. Один из самых распространенных языков программирования для PLC — это логический язык Ladder Diagram (LD). Внешне он аналогичен электрической схеме, состоящей из контактов и катушек, и позволяет легко визуализировать логические операции и управляющие сигналы.
Пишется программа для PLC постепенно, шаг за шагом, с использованием элементов языка LD. Операции выполняются последовательно, и каждый шаг зависит от результата предыдущего. Для управления работой PLC в программе используются условные операторы, циклы, функции и триггеры.
Программирование PLC также включает в себя настройку аппаратных параметров контроллера, таких как задание входов и выходов, настройка сетевых соединений и привязка устройств. Для этого используется специализированное программное обеспечение от производителя PLC.
Программирование PLC требует глубоких знаний в области автоматизации и электротехники. Построение эффективной программы для PLC требует понимания специфики выполняемых процессов и умения анализировать и оптимизировать управляющие сигналы и логические операции.
Преимущества программирования PLC | Недостатки программирования PLC |
---|---|
Гибкость и масштабируемость | Сложность отладки |
Быстрота разработки | Необходимость постоянного обновления программы |
Возможность самодиагностики | Сложность программирования для сложных систем |
Программирование PLC — это неотъемлемая часть работы автоматизаторов и специалистов в области промышленной автоматизации. Грамотно написанная программа для PLC может значительно повысить эффективность и надежность работы производственных процессов.
Применение PLC в промышленности
Программируемые логические контроллеры (PLC) широко применяются в промышленности для автоматизации различных процессов и систем. Благодаря своей гибкости, надежности и простоте использования, PLC стал неотъемлемой частью современных промышленных систем.
Одним из основных преимуществ PLC является возможность программирования логики управления. PLC выполняет различные задачи, такие как мониторинг и контроль работы оборудования, управление процессами и системами, сбор и анализ данных и многое другое. PLC способен обрабатывать большие объемы информации и быстро реагировать на изменения внешних условий.
Применение PLC в промышленности охватывает широкий спектр отраслей, включая производство, энергетику, нефтегазовую промышленность, пищевую промышленность, сельское хозяйство и многое другое.
В производственных системах PLC используется для управления различными процессами, такими как автоматическая сборка и упаковка продукции, контроль качества, управление складами и логистикой, управление роботами и многое другое.
В энергетической отрасли PLC используется для управления и контроля энергетических систем, включая питание и распределение электроэнергии, управление турбинами и генераторами, контроль системы энергоснабжения и многое другое.
В нефтегазовой промышленности PLC применяется для управления буровыми установками, контроля состояния и безопасности оборудования, управления системами транспорта и хранения нефти и газа и другими важными функциями.
В пищевой промышленности PLC играет важную роль в управлении и контроле процессов производства пищевых продуктов, включая контроль температуры, давления и других параметров, управление системами смешивания и упаковки, контроль качества и безопасности продукции.
В сельском хозяйстве PLC применяется для автоматизации различных сельскохозяйственных процессов, таких как контроль полива и орошения, управление системами подачи кормов для животных, автоматизация работы транспортных средств и многое другое.
Применение PLC в промышленности продолжает расти и развиваться. Эта технология играет все более важную роль в улучшении производительности, эффективности и безопасности промышленных систем, благодаря своим преимуществам и возможностям.
Применение PLC в автоматизации
Основное преимущество PLC перед классическими электромеханическими системами – это его гибкость и простота программирования. С использованием специальных языков программирования, таких как Ladder Logic, Structured Text или Function Block Diagram, инженеры могут легко создавать и изменять логику работы контроллера.
PLC используется для автоматизации самых разнообразных процессов. Он может контролировать работу промышленных роботов, механических подъемников, конвейеров, систем отопления и вентиляции, систем обработки воды, систем безопасности и многого другого.
В основе работы PLC лежит так называемый сканирующий цикл. Контроллер периодически сканирует все подключенные к нему датчики и исполнительные устройства, а затем принимает решения на основе полученной информации. Например, если датчик обнаруживает, что температура в помещении стала слишком высокой, контроллер может отправить команду на запуск кондиционера.
Применение PLC в автоматизации: | Примеры использования: |
---|---|
Производство | Контроль линий сборки, управление роботами, мониторинг параметров процесса |
Энергетика | Управление генераторами, дистрибьюция электроэнергии, мониторинг энергопотребления |
Горнодобывающая промышленность | Управление штрековыми печами, контроль выработки, управление складами |
Сельское хозяйство | Управление системами полива, контроль качества почвы, автоматическое кормление животных |
Системы безопасности | Управление системами сигнализации, контроль доступа, видеонаблюдение |
Благодаря своей надежности, гибкости и простоте программирования, PLC стал незаменимым инструментом в автоматизации процессов управления. Он значительно упрощает работу инженеров и повышает эффективность производства. Будущее PLC обещает еще больше возможностей и инноваций в области автоматизации.
Преимущества использования PLC
1. Надежность и долговечность: В основе работы PLC лежит микропроцессор, который обеспечивает надежность и стабильность функционирования системы. Благодаря этому PLC обладает высокой долговечностью и способен работать без сбоев на протяжении длительного времени.
2. Простота программирования и настройки: PLC имеет интуитивно понятный интерфейс программирования, который позволяет быстро и легко настроить управляющую программу для выполнения требуемых операций. Это делает PLC доступным даже для пользователей без опыта в программировании.
3. Гибкость и масштабируемость: PLC обладает гибкостью и возможностью легкой модификации программы, а также возможностью добавлять дополнительное оборудование без необходимости полной замены системы. Это позволяет адаптировать PLC под разные условия работы и изменять его функционал в соответствии с потребностями процесса.
4. Возможность диагностики и отладки: PLC обеспечивает возможность мониторинга и диагностики работы системы, а также предоставляет средства отладки программы. Это значительно упрощает обнаружение и устранение возможных ошибок в работе системы.
5. Высокая скорость и точность работы: PLC способен выполнять большое количество операций за короткое время и обеспечивать высокую точность выполнения команд. Это позволяет эффективно управлять и контролировать различные процессы и повышать производительность системы.
6. Безопасность: PLC обладает встроенными средствами защиты от несанкционированного доступа и механизмами аварийной остановки системы. Это значительно повышает уровень безопасности работы и предотвращает возможные аварийные ситуации.
7. Экономическая эффективность: PLC позволяет оптимизировать процессы и сократить затраты на энергию, обслуживание и ремонт оборудования. Благодаря этому использование PLC может привести к снижению общей стоимости владения системой управления.
PLC и современные технологии
Одной из основных современных технологий, которые широко используются в PLC, является Ethernet. Ethernet-соединение позволяет быстро и надежно передавать данные с PLC на центральный сервер или между различными устройствами. Это особенно полезно для обработки больших объемов данных и информационного обмена.
Другой современной технологией, которая изменила PLC, является возможность программирования на языке высокого уровня, таком как C или C++. Это дала возможность разработчикам разрабатывать более сложные и мощные программы, которые могут выполнять сложные математические и логические операции. Таким образом, PLC стали гораздо более гибкими и могут эффективно работать с различными задачами.
Также стоит отметить рост популярности облачных технологий и Интернета вещей. PLC стали активно использоваться в системах, где данные обрабатываются в облаке, а устройства сбора информации подключаются к интернету. Это значительно улучшает мониторинг и контроль системы, а также позволяет удаленно управлять PLC через интернет.
Таким образом, PLC активно применяют современные технологии, что делает их более эффективными и удобными в использовании. Они все еще остаются незаменимыми в промышленной автоматизации и продолжают развиваться, чтобы соответствовать требованиям современного производства.